🎫 🎫 Tickets & Entry
No, entry to the Municipal Market itself is free. You only pay for any items you wish to purchase from the vendors.
The indoor shops are open daily. The outdoor flea market operates on Wednesdays and Saturdays from 8 AM to 2 PM, and a handicraft market is held on Sundays from 10 AM to 2 PM.
For the full experience with both indoor and outdoor vendors, Wednesdays and Saturdays are the busiest and most comprehensive market days. Sundays are dedicated to the handicraft market.

Exploring the Market's Offerings
The outdoor market, particularly on Wednesdays and Saturdays, transforms into a bustling flea market. Here, you can discover a wide array of items, from second-hand goods and collectibles to unique handmade crafts and jewelry. Some visitors describe it as a lively 'jumble sale', while others appreciate the eclectic mix and the opportunity to find hidden gems. It's a place where locals and tourists mingle, creating an energetic atmosphere.
Beyond shopping, the market is a social space. Cafes and bars are situated upstairs, offering a perfect spot to relax, enjoy a coffee, and observe the market's daily life. This blend of commerce, community, and casual dining makes the Municipal Market a multifaceted destination.
